The Basotho made their way down as various tribes settled in different … WebThe Sesotho idiom refers to the fact that men are not supposed to cry because it’s a sign of weakness, they are supposed to toughen up and take whatever comes”. The Sepedi tradition has a similar outlook: “A man is not expected to cry even if he feels pain, but a woman can cry in case of pain. It is said man is a sheep and a woman is a goat”.
